We have a baby about 10 inches and shes acting funny. She stops breathing than finally she will beard and open her mouth and gasp for air than she stops breathing again. When she gasps for air you can see her take in a few breaths than stops. She just started to shead too i dont know if that makes a diffrence.
 

AHBD

BD.org Sicko
Hi there....is she doing it constantly ? Did she just eat a big meal, or large piece of veggie ? Sometimes they breath hard after eating something that's on the large side. Also, when they shed their beard the puff it out to stretch the skin off. Is she still doing it ? If it's constant and she doesn't stop, she may be choking on something + would need to see a vet.

How is she ? Still struggling ? It could be a respiratory infection. Sometimes they make a popping sound when they open their mouth to gasp [ like the last poster mentioned ] but not always. If so, she'll need some antibiotics, and keep her tank about 80 degrees at night .Poor girl, hope she gets over this soon.

Have you recently given her a bath & could she have aspirated some water during her bath?
Until you can get her to a vet, I would keep her around 80 overnight in her tank with either a heating pad or a ceramic heat emitter to help keep her immune system boosted.
